System Messages
This is data that is used in common by the entire MIDI
system. These include System Exclusive messages for
transferring data unique to each instrument manufac-
turer and Realtime messages for controlling the MIDI
device.
The messages transmitted/received by the PSR-S900/
S700 are shown in the MIDI Data Format and MIDI
Implementation Chart in the Data List. The Data List is
available at the Yamaha website. (See page 5.)

MIDI Data Compatibility
This section covers basic information on data compati-
bility: whether or not other MIDI devices can playback
the data recorded by PSR-S900/S700, and whether or
not the PSR-S900/S700 can playback commercially
available song data or song data created for other
instruments or on a computer. Depending on the MIDI
device or data characteristics, you may be able to play
back the data without any problem, or you may have to
perform some special operations before the data can be
played back. If you run into problems playing back
data, please refer to the information below.
Sequence Formats
Song data is recorded and stored in a variety of different
systems, referred to as “sequence formats.”
Playback is only possible when the sequence format of
the Song data matches that of the MIDI device. The
PSR-S900/S700 is compatible with the following for-
mats.
SMF (Standard MIDI file)
This is the most common sequence format. Standard
MIDI Files are generally available as one of two types:
Format 0 or Format 1. Many MIDI devices are compati-
ble with Format 0, and most commercially available
software is recorded as Format 0.
•The PSR-S900/S700 is compatible with both Format 0
and Format 1.
• Song data recorded on the PSR-S900/S700 is auto-
matically saved as SMF Format 0.
ESEQ
This sequence format is compatible with many of
Yamaha’s MIDI devices, including the PSR-S900/S700
series instruments. This is a common format used with
various Yamaha software.
•The PSR-S900/S700 is compatible with ESEQ.
XF
The Yamaha XF format enhances the SMF (Standard
MIDI File) format with greater functionality and open-
ended expandability for the future. The PSR-S900/S700
is capable of displaying lyrics when an XF file contain-
ing lyric data is played. (SMF is the most common for-
mat used for MIDI sequence files. The PSR-S900/S700 is
compatible with SMF Formats 0 and 1, and records
“song” data using SMF Format 0.)
